  • Welcome to the First Episode of this Electric G-Body Cutlass Conversion!
    This car still has the original 307 internal combustion engine and is far off from being remotely an EV, but while waiting and saving for the bigger components we can focus on some of the small things that need to happen at some point during an EV conversion.
    Number 1 on my list! Power Steering!
